![]() ![]() Is there any reason for your "periodic pushes"? If no one else is working on the same branch it would be perfectly fine, just to push after finishing everything. Usually you just want git pull -rebase which is essentially git fetch plus git rebase, and creates a much cleaner history. (equivalent to giving the -ff-only option from the command line).īe aware that git pull is just a combination of git fetch and git merge. The git pull command is a combination of two other Git commands: git fetch and git merge. I hope this guide helps you and your teams become more inclusive Jun 16 20. If there are any conflicts, Git will notify. This command will merge the changes from master into your TruckTemplates branch. Once you are on the TruckTemplates branch, use the git merge command to merge the changes from master into it: git merge master. Navigate to Code > Branches and delete master. Switch to your feature branch using the git checkout command: git checkout TruckTemplates. ![]() When set to only, only such fast-forward merges are allowed Navigate to your repository > Settings > Branches. This variable tells Git to create an extra merge commit in such aĬase (equivalent to giving the -no-ff option from the command What is a branch and visualize branchesIndependent line of development or parallel development of code along with the main code.Branches are used to develop a new feature or to fix a bug in the code.In other words:Branch is a reference to a commit. index.html 1 + 1 file changed, 1 insertion (+) This looks a bit different than the hotfix merge you did earlier. Tip of the current branch is fast-forwarded. All you have to do is check out the branch you wish to merge into and then run the git merge command: git checkout master Switched to branch 'master' git merge iss53 Merge made by the 'recursive' strategy. You can omit the -no-ff after setting git config -global merge.ff false.īy default, Git does not create an extra merge commit when mergingĪ commit that is a descendant of the current commit. Git fetch updates your remote branches, there usually is no need to have a local copy of a branch when your are not planning to work on this branch. ![]()
0 Comments
Leave a Reply. |